我有一些Python代碼用於創建隨機遊走的情節。步行將反映[-a,a]的障礙。序列中的隨後的值是由 r[n] = r[n-1] + Uni[-R, R]
,然後將其反映爲必要生成。我想要做的是繪製每個點周圍的「不確定性錐」,[-R, R]。 這裏是Python代碼到目前爲止我有: import matplotlib.pyplot as plt
import random
uni = ra
該代碼應該是一個隨機walker,運行的次數是用戶輸入的次數,如果walker設法達到遊戲板的邊緣,他將贏得或如果步行者永遠回到他的起始位置,他輸了。現在我的代碼運行,但勝利和失敗不等於次 # Project 3 yay
#right now my win loss ratio is wrong///very off
from random import choice #choice make
我有以下代碼意想不到輸出: import random
N = 30 # number of steps
n = random.random() # generate a random number
x = 0
y = 0
z = 0
count = 0
while count <= N:
if n < 1/3:
x = x + 1 # move east
我在寫一個非常簡單的隨機漫遊功能。整個代碼如下。當前成本函數小於前一個時,我使用數組來跟蹤參數值。但出於某種原因,跟蹤輸出的數組是重寫?以前的條目。我認爲它與將參數附加爲「c」有關,因此存在內存分配問題,因爲「c」是附加的而不是c的值,但我不知道如何解決這個問題,也不知道爲什麼它與成本函數值psi不同,後者按預期追加並保持其值。 我想創造的東西,如: input:
for n in N:
if